Capstan Way art project nears fruition

Capstan Way art project nears fruition

A piece of public artwork entitled Traceries is planned for the Capstan Way Sanitary Pump Station Plaza, according to a city report. The work will envelope the station and incorporate drawings, a neighbourhood map and a possible vine trellis.
Could Lang Park become food truck central?

Could Lang Park become food truck central?

A redevelopment concept plan for Lang Park, next to the Richmond Public Market, could soon be approved and it could usher in a new era of food trucks in the city’s urban core.
